Post & Organization Details
The Wildlife Institute of India (WII), an autonomous institution under the 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change, is located at Chandrabani, Dehradun. It conducts cutting‑edge research on wildlife conservation, ecology, and environmental management.

Eligibility Criteria
Educational Qualification
- Administrative Assistant / Scientific Administrative Assistant / Field Worker: Graduation degree in any discipline from a recognized university.
- Project Assistant (Science‑based projects): Bachelor’s degree in a science stream (Wildlife Science, Zoology, Ecology, Marine Sciences, etc.).
- Project Assistant (Social Science): Bachelor’s degree in any social science discipline (Geography, Statistics, Economics, Public Administration, etc.).
- Project Associate‑I: Four‑year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Natural Sciences, Agricultural/Forestry Sciences, or BVSc.
- Project Associate‑II: Four‑year Bachelor’s/Master’s in Natural or Agricultural Sciences with 2 years R&D experience, or BVSc with 2 years experience, or Engineering/Technology degree with 2 years experience.
- Senior Project Associate: Four‑year Bachelor’s with 4 years R&D experience, or Master’s with 4 years experience, or Doctoral degree in relevant field.

Selection Process
- Shortlisting based on essential qualification, age limit, percentage of marks, relevance of specialization, research experience and publications.
- Scoring pattern (total 50 marks) varies by post:
- Field/Lab/Project Assistant: 25 marks for % marks in Bachelor’s degree, 25 marks for specialization relevance.
- Project Associate‑I: 25 marks for % marks in Master’s degree, 25 marks for specialization relevance.
- Project Associate‑II / Senior Project Associate / Principal Project Associate / Project Scientist: 5 marks for NET/JRF, 25 marks for % marks in Post‑Graduation, 10 marks for research/work experience, 10 marks for publications.
- Top 10 shortlisted candidates per position will be called for an online interview.
- Final selection will be based on interview performance and overall score. The Institute’s decision is final and binding.
